## **What Is Kylebooker Pearlescent Braid Mylar Tubing?**

This product is a **holographic mylar braid** used primarily in fly tying to create flashy, iridescent bodies for streamers, nymphs, and other artificial flies. The **pearlescent finish** gives it a realistic, fish-attracting shimmer, mimicking the natural reflections of baitfish and insects. The **round, hollow tubing structure** makes it easy to wrap around hooks or slide over tying thread, offering versatility in fly patterns.
